The delta strain of CORONAVIRUS in Japan could have self-destructed due to the fact that too many mutations have accumulated in the nsp14 protein, which is responsible for the ability of the virus to correct mutations. This was stated by DOCTOR of Biology, Professor of the School of Systems Biology at George Mason University Ancha Baranova in an interview with Lenta.ru.

“Since there was one delta in Japan, according to Japanese colleagues, mutations in the nsp14 protein have accumulated in it. <...> But since nsp14 itself had “deteriorated”, it could not fix anything, errors began to multiply uncontrollably. And, in the end, the virus came to a sad end for itself, ”said Baranova. She also added that the "corrupted" delta strain in Japan eventually resulted in copies with weakened mutation-correction capabilities.

As other reasons for the possible disappearance of the delta strain, she named the lack of a wide variety of strains in the country, the isolation of Japan as an island nation, and strict adherence to anti-coronavirus measures by the population.

However, the HEAD of the scientific group for the development of new methods for diagnosing human diseases, the Central Research Institute of Epidemiology of Rospotrebnadzor, Kamil Khafizov, said that it was difficult for him to imagine a situation in which the virus mutated so that it suddenly lost the ability to reproduce, but at the same time multiplied widely among the population. “I'm afraid the reality looks very different. So far, we note that the “delta” line in all countries is constantly mutating and dissociating into daughter sub-lines, which can potentially become even more dangerous, ”Khafizov said (quoted by RIA Novosti).
